"Lightened Up" Buffalo Chicken Dip"

Ingredients:


*1 block (8 oz.) Neufchatel cheese
* 8 oz. 2% shredded mozzarella cheese
*2 12.75 oz. cans of chicken breast (98% fat free, I used Swanson)
*1/2 Cup Frank's Red Hot Sauce (or Louisiana, or Texas Pete-- whatever you want... no "wing" sauce, though)
*1/2 Cup Hidden Valley Light Ranch Dressing


Directions:

Preheat oven to 350.

In a bowl, combine neufchatel cheese, 4 oz. shredded mozzarella, ranch dressing and hot sauce. Mix it all together (I used a hand mixer).

Drain cans of chicken breast, and break big chunks apart. Stir both cans into the cheese-hot sauce mixture.

Spoon chicken mixture into a small baking dish (I used a 9x9) and top with remaining 4 ounces of mozzarella.

Bake at 350 for about 20 minutes or until cheese is melted and dish is bubbling.

Serve hot!



Nutrition for 1/8 of recipe: 235 cals/ 2 carbs/ 9 fat/ 17 protein



***The recipe could be further lightened by using fat free cream cheese, fat free mozzarella and fat free ranch. That said, I think you might sacrifice some flavor there, and for me (since I'm low carb), it adds some sugar to the recipe. You might want to try, though!



You can also serve it with celery or carrots, or with baked chips if that's your thing! Enjoy!

    I love this with celery. I don't put the ranch in mine either but I always use low-fat cheese. I usually use boiled boneless skinless breasts that I shred by hand because I think the canned chicken gives it a slightly different flavour but I've been using the canned stuff more and more recently.
